So I have a simple working adhoc wifi LAN between my 030 A1200 and my Win7 PC using Amigakit's Easynet kit. It does a pretty fine job for accessing shared folders in the PC from miggy side and doing some basic web-surfing with Aweb in a 3.1 setup, which was all I expected of it... untill now!

Today I feel a bit more ambitious and would like playing networked ADoom games between my A1200 and WinUAE in the PC... if possible at all!

Just marking the bdsocket and uaenet.device (with WinPcap installed as suggested) options inside WinUAE won't do the job. ADoom in the A1200 seems to recognise the PC side as it states it is either "listening" or "sending a start signal" (depending on -net 1 or -net 2 parameter) but ADoom inside WinUAE won't reach that point, exiting with a "can't find" amiga machine message.

So I guess I'm missing something. Should I install AmiTCP in the WinUAE emulated Amiga? That was not necessary for web-surfing from WinUAE, but perhaps is required for this. Any other thing I should know? Have someone done this before? As I said, I'm not even sure wether it can actually be done or it's just my imagination running wild ^_^'

My ultimate goal is doing some networked ADoom betwwen my A1200 and a wifi equipped netbook I'm likely to buy soon so I could bring some Amiga-Doom fun to local Retrogaming meetings. Any help would be much appreciated!

I didnt think winuae would let you use both net options at the same time but ...oh well.  When using winpcap, youll need to use a tcp stack like amitcp/genesis/miami and uaenet.device (make sure enabled in winuae) will be availble to use as the sana2 driver for the tcp stack.  This will implant the amiga with bsdsocket.lib so make sure this option is dissabled in winuae.

Then configure just like an actual amiga and i think youll be good to go, and i can see a reason why the doom link wouldnt work.   Youll also be able to browse through this link too.
